Bass of the Week: Aron Bach 4-String Double Cut

Aron Bach built basses under the Tuli name when he lived in Finland. Now he’s settled in the US and has restarted his instrument building. This week, we’re checking out his 4-String Double Cut with a Transparent Faded Blue finish.

Bass of the Week: Manne Guitars Multi Bass 6

Most music trade shows got canceled in 2020, but that didn’t stop the flow of great ideas and instruments. It was that year at the virtual Holy Grail Guitar Show that Manne Guitars unveiled their new Multi Bass, which was created with the ideas and input of Daniele Camarda.

Bass of the Week: Dooley Designs 5-string P/J Bass

This week we’re checking out a five-string P/J bass by Dooley Designs. Luthier Scott Dooley called this bass another learning experience due to its 35-inch scale, preamp mods, extra neck layers, and more.

Bass of the Week: Saitias Guitars Lexell 5

Japan’s Saitias Guitars recently shared their new Lexell model, and it’s a real beauty. The bass, named after a comet not seen since the 1770s, was designed as a versatile tool with the help of bassist Wakazaemon.

Bass of the Week: Carillion Guitars Promethean 6 Singlecut

This week we’re checking out a Promethean 6 Singlecut by Carillion Guitars. Built for Martino Garattoni of Ne Obliviscaris, the bass is a six-string featuring their Promethean body and Reaver headstock.

Bass of the Week: Tiny Boy Bass TBP-3400BFM

Micro basses have been growing in popularity over the past few years. This week we’re checking out the Tiny Boy TBP-3400BFM, which has a miniature 23-inch scale. The four-string bass still has 22 frets on its ebony fingerboard.

Bass of the Week: RJ Customs Valupture

Richard Greenup of RJ Custom recently shared photos of one of his newest builds called the Valupture. The Australian luthier put a magnificent piece of poplar burl on full display for the top and headstock cap.
